Art
- The child learned about composition and balance by placing different elements in the drawing.
- Color theory was experienced as the child selected and mixed colors to use in the drawings.
- Observational skills were honed as the child captured details and proportions in their drawings.
- Using different drawing techniques, such as shading and hatching, allowed the child to explore texture and depth.
Encourage the child to experiment with different mediums and styles, such as pen and ink, charcoal, or watercolor, to further develop their skills and artistic expression. Visiting art museums and galleries can also inspire new ideas and appreciation for different art forms.
Book Recommendations
- The Drawing Lesson: A Graphic Novel That Teaches You How to Draw by Mark Crilley: This book combines storytelling and drawing lessons, making it an engaging resource for young artists.
- How to Draw Cool Stuff: A Drawing Guide for Teachers and Students by Catherine V. Holmes: This book provides step-by-step instructions for learning to draw various objects and scenes.
- Art for Kids: Drawing by Kathryn Temple: A great resource for young artists, providing guidance and inspiration for drawing different subjects.
